Clash’s first episode – .NET vs Java

Last week Accedia held its first Сблъсък* event. Сблъсък will be a regular occurrence where Accedia team members will take the boxing ring and debate on topics they’re passionate and knowledgeable about. All the while the rest of us sit back with a bag of popcorn and enjoy.

In оur very first Сблъсък episode the contestants were two of our senior software consultants and the topic was .NET vs Java. Part of Accedia for over 6 years, Stoyan Atanasov and Lazar Lazarov (Lazo) were rooting respectively for .NET and Java. Stoyan is a .NET master with a wide range of web and mobile applications under his belt. Lazo, on the other hand, has a strong background in both .NET and Java, however, ultimately chose to devote himself to Java and prove that it’s just as capable and powerful as .NET.

Some of the main topics discussed were how easy it is to get started with .NET and Java and how long does it take to master them.  Also what ORM (Object-relational mapping) tools Lazo and Stoyan use; what does the unit testing look like; what is the current development state of both languages, and much more.

During the first episode “.NET vs Java” we had some passionate discussions and arguments from both sides of the ring, however, in the end, the audience had spoken. With 25 votes for .NET and 19 for Java, the winner in the first-ever episode of Сблъсък was .NET, endorsed by Stoyan Atanasov.
